iHerb, LLC logo
iHerb, LLC

Come join the movement....we are a vehicle to healthy living!

Senior Software Engineer II – AI

Full-stack EngineerSoftware EngineerFull TimeRemoteSeniorTeam 1,001-5,000Since 1996H1B No SponsorCompany SiteLinkedIn

Location

United States

Posted

2 days ago

Salary

$187K - $235K / year

Seniority

Senior

Bachelor Degree10 yrs expEnglishPythonSDLC

Job Description

Senior Software Engineer II – AI

iHerb, LLC

• Lead the build of GenAI-powered product experiences and shared AI platform infrastructure • Design, build, and operate production AI features • Build shared AI platform layer including retrieval infrastructure and eval frameworks • Write LLM applications and integrations with marketing platforms and BI tools • Evaluate model and feature quality using structured eval frameworks • Use AI-driven SDLC tooling for AI and non-AI code • Coordinate with the Personalization team • Document AI system design decisions and operational lessons • Own the observability of AI systems built including latency, cost, quality drift, and error rates

Job Requirements

  • 10+ years of software engineering experience
  • Hands-on experience shipping production code with AI-assisted development tools such as Claude Code, GitHub Copilot, or Cursor
  • Comfortable contributing across layers of the stack
  • Experience owning features end-to-end from spec through deployment
  • Strong grasp of software design principles, automated testing, code review, and CI/CD
  • Fully autonomous; drives technical decisions within the team; mentors junior engineers
  • Python proficiency; comfortable building and operating production LLM applications
  • Experience with at least one specialization: RAG and retrieval systems, LLM evaluation, agentic frameworks (LangChain, LlamaIndex or similar), or LLM-based workflow automation
  • Understanding of prompt engineering, context window management, and LLM output quality tradeoffs
  • Familiarity with vector databases, embedding models, or semantic search
  • High degree of accuracy and attention to detail
  • Excellent organization skills and ability to multi-task

Benefits

  • Medical, dental, vision, and basic life insurance programs
  • Enrollment in the company’s 401(k) plan
  • Paid Time Off
  • Paid Sick Leave
  • Paid holidays throughout the calendar year
  • Potential award of Restrict Stock Units
  • Annual bonuses pursuant to eligibility and performance criteria

Related Job Pages

More Full-stack Engineer Jobs

Safeguard Global logo

Software Engineer

Safeguard Global

Your global HR partner in 170+ countries. Our on-the-ground support makes it easy to hire and pay your global workforce.

Full TimeRemoteTeam 1,001-5,000H1B No Sponsor

• Design and ship agentic systems end-to-end — tool calling, sub-agent orchestration, memory, durable state, and failure recovery. • Build evaluation frameworks from the ground up — golden datasets, regression harnesses, and systematic approaches to measuring whether your AI systems actually work. • Own AI features from prototype to production: observable, maintainable, cost-aware. • Work with product and domain engineers to identify where AI has real leverage — and where it doesn't. • Contribute to how we build AI across the org: patterns, tooling, and standards that others build on. • Manage the operational economics of AI systems — latency, token cost, context efficiency — as first-class engineering concerns.

Spain
€74K / year
IEBT Innovation logo

Senior Developer – Software Engineering, AI

IEBT Innovation

Corporate Innovation and Digital Transformation

Full TimeRemoteTeam 51-200Since 2009H1B No Sponsor

• Develop and maintain applications using Python (back end) and React (front end). • Use AI tools extensively (coding assistants, AI-assisted development) to accelerate delivery and solve complex problems. • Navigate and contribute to large, complex legacy codebases autonomously. • Develop web applications with JavaScript/TypeScript and ReactJS, including unit and end-to-end tests (Playwright). • Work with AWS services (Lambda, S3, DynamoDB, Aurora, among others). • Ensure adherence to coding standards and perform code reviews, ensuring scalable, high-performance applications. • Contribute improvements to DevOps processes and cloud infrastructure when necessary. • Participate in the full software development lifecycle (SDLC).

Brazil

Develop software applications and tests, automate processes, and enhance application security. Leverage metrics for decisions and analyze industry requirements to provide insights for an enterprise-wide data inventory effort.

Florida
GoMining logo

FullStack Engineer

GoMining

We make Bitcoin mining simple, accessible and fun.

Full TimeRemoteTeam 201-500Since 2017H1B No Sponsor

We are looking for a** FullStack Engineer **with a strong backend focus to help build and scale Enterprise products. You will work closely with Product and Engineering teams to develop partner-facing experiences, widgets, and internal applications. **Responsibilities - Build and maintain frontend applications, widgets, partner portals, and landing pages. - Design and implement backend services and APIs. - Prototype new partner integrations and B2B solutions. - Work closely with Product Managers and Designers from requirements to production. - Own features end-to-end, including deployment and support. - Participate in code reviews and architecture discussions. - Actively leverage AI tools to accelerate development and increase productivity.

Cyprus